North Carolina General Statutes § 106-307.4 Quarantine of inoculated poultry

All poultry that are inoculated with a product containing a living virus or other organism capable of causing disease shall be quarantined at the time of inoculation in accordance with regulations promulgated by the State Board of Agriculture. Provided nothing herein contained shall be construed as preventing anyone entitled to administer vaccines under existing laws from continuing to administer  same. (1969, c. 606, s. 1.)
